Grilled Corn Salad

Ingredients for Grilled Corn Salad:

This vibrant Grilled Corn Salad showcases fresh ingredients, perfect for a summer side dish or a light meal. Here’s what you need:

  • 4 ears of corn, husk removed
  • 1 teaspoon of olive oil
  • Salt and pepper, for seasoning corn
  • ½ cup of red onion, diced
  • ½ cup of red bell pepper, diced
  • ¾ cup of English cucumber, diced
  • ½ an avocado, diced
  • ½ cup of cherry tomatoes, quartered
  • 1 clove of garlic, minced
  • 1 tablespoon of jalapeno, minced
  • 1 tablespoon of cilantro, chopped
  • 2 tablespoons of sunflower seeds

Make the Cilantro Lime Dressing

  • ¼ cup of extra virgin olive oil
  • 2 tablespoons of mint, chopped
  • ¼ cup of cilantro, chopped
  • 2 tablespoons of apple cider vinegar
  • 1 tablespoon of lime juice
  • Zest of 1 lime
  • 1 teaspoon of honey, or a vegan alternative like maple syrup
  • 1 clove of garlic, minced
  • ½ teaspoon of salt
  • Freshly ground black pepper, to taste

How to Prepare Grilled Corn Salad:

To create a refreshing Grilled Corn Salad, start by grilling fresh corn. Brush four ears of corn with olive oil and season them with salt and pepper. Preheat your grill, then place the corn on it, cooking for 10-12 minutes while rotating to achieve a nice char. Once cooled, cut the kernels off the cobs and place them in a large mixing bowl. Add in diced red onion, red bell pepper, English cucumber, and quartered cherry tomatoes. Then include diced avocado, minced garlic, and jalapeño for that extra kick. Finally, sprinkle in chopped cilantro and sunflower seeds for a delightful crunch.

Next, make a zesty Cilantro Lime Dressing. Blend together extra virgin olive oil, chopped mint, apple cider vinegar, lime juice, lime zest, honey, minced garlic, and season with salt and pepper. Drizzle this dressing over the salad and toss gently to combine all flavors.

Delicious Grilled Corn Salad with Fresh Vegetables

Grilled Corn Salad: Deliciously Easy & Crowd-Pleasing Recipe


  • Total Time: 50
  • Yield: 4 servings 1x

Description

This Grilled Corn Salad is a delightful combination of fresh vegetables and smoky grilled corn, topped with a zesty cilantro lime dressing that brings everything together.


Ingredients

Scale

4 ears of corn husk removed

1 teaspoon of olive oil

salt and pepper for seasoning corn

½ cup of red onion diced

½ cup of red bell pepper diced

¾ cup of english cucumber diced

½ an avocado diced

½ cup of cherry tomatoes quartered

1 clove of garlic minced

1 tablespoon of jalapeno minced

1 tablespoon of cilantro chopped

2 tablespoons of sunflower seeds

¼ cup of extra virgin olive oil

2 tablespoons of mint chopped

¼ cup of cilantro chopped

2 tablespoons of apple cider vinegar

1 tablespoon of lime juice

zest of 1 lime

1 teaspoon of honey or maple syrup or agave for vegan alternative

1 clove of garlic minced

½ teaspoon of salt

freshly ground black pepper to taste


Instructions

  • Lightly brush each of the ears of corn with olive oil and then generously sprinkle with salt and pepper.
  • Heat your grill and once hot, add corn. Cook for 2-3 minutes on each side, rotating so that every side gets a bit charred, 10-12 minutes total. Once done, let cool enough to handle and then cut the kernels off of the cob and transfer to a large bowl.
  • Add the onion, bell pepper, cucumber, tomato, avocado, garlic, jalapeno, sunflower seeds and cilantro to the bowl.
  • Make your dressing by adding all of the dressing ingredients to a blender and blend until combined. About 30 seconds. Season with salt and pepper to taste.
  • Drizzle the dressing onto the corn salad and combine. Season with additional salt and pepper to taste and enjoy!

Notes

For a spicier kick, feel free to add more jalapeno or a dash of hot sauce. This salad is best served fresh but can be stored in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 2 days.
